Microsoft Windows DHCP Client Service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

Vulnerability

A remote code execution vulnerability has been identified in the DHCP Client Service on Windows Server 2025, Windows 11 Version 24H2 for x64-based and ARM64-based Systems, and Windows Server 2025 (Server Core installation). This vulnerability arises from a use-after-free error, allowing attackers to execute arbitrary code remotely.

Impact

Exploitation of this vulnerability allows for remote code execution on the affected system.

Remediation

Users can apply the security update KB5051987 to address this vulnerability. This update is available through the Microsoft Update Catalog.
